Have seen various discussions about replacing a Sonos speaker with a new or different one, but the old one still shows in the app as “not connected”. I could not find a way to manually make this “not connected” disappear from the app. Tried reconnecting and removing again but no luck. However, by simply waiting 72 hours or so, the “not connected” stopped appearing and there was no reference to the old speaker in the app. (This was replacing a Gen 3 with a Gen 4 sub, but should apply to any other speaker.)
